GP surgery in Northolt

Islip Manor Medical Centre

45 Eastcote Lane, Northolt, UB5 5RG

Taking on new patientsInspection: Good6,481 patients

Scores 29 out of 100, below average for a GP surgery in England. 69% of patients say their experience is good and 65% find it easy to get through on the phone (England: 77% and 57%). Inspectors rated it Good in 2022. It is taking on new patients.

Below average Scores higher than 29% of GP surgeries in England. 6th of 9 in Northolt Based on 133 patient survey replies, the inspection rating and NHS records.

Common questions

Is Islip Manor Medical Centre taking on new patients?

Yes. When we last checked its page on the NHS website (20 September 2026), Islip Manor Medical Centre was taking on new patients. You can register online through the NHS website or call the surgery on 020 8845 4911.

How do patients rate Islip Manor Medical Centre?

In the 2026 NHS GP Patient Survey, 69% of patients at Islip Manor Medical Centre said their overall experience was good. The England average is 77%. 65% found it easy to get through by phone (England 57%). Its GPScore is 29 out of 100, grade D, which puts it in the second-worst 20% of GP surgeries in England.

What is the inspection rating for Islip Manor Medical Centre?

The Care Quality Commission, which inspects GP surgeries in England, rated Islip Manor Medical Centre as Good at its last published inspection (report published 27 September 2022).

What are the opening times of Islip Manor Medical Centre?

Reception is open Monday 8am to 6:30pm, Tuesday 8am to 8pm, Wednesday 8am to 6:30pm, Thursday 8am to 6:30pm, Friday 8am to 6:30pm, Saturday closed, Sunday closed. The surgery last confirmed these times on 23 March 2024. Bank holidays may differ.

How do I contact Islip Manor Medical Centre?

Call 020 8845 4911 or visit its website, www.islipmanorsurgery.co.uk. You can also book and order repeat prescriptions in the NHS App. The address is 45 Eastcote Lane, Northolt, UB5 5RG.

How many patients are registered at Islip Manor Medical Centre?

Around 6,481 patients are registered (January 2025). The surgery is part of Ngp PCN, a group of local surgeries that share staff and services, in the West and North London NHS area.
